  • Page 9: Charging Modes And Description

    CHARGING MODES AND DESCRIPTION Charging mode 3B In charging mode 3B, a mobile AC charging cable is required (Connection Cable), which has a connector at both ends. One end, the ve- hicle charging plug, is inserted into the inlet of the vehicle. The other end of the charging cable, the infrastructure charging connector, is inserted into the charging socket of the charging station.

  • Page 23: Connector Operation

    CONNECTOR OPERATION The 2-end Connection Cable is used to connect the electric vehicle and the charg- ing station. 1. The Vehicle Connector must be plugged into the charging inlet (vehicle) and the Equipment Plug into the charging outlet (station). 2. Ensure that connector and plug are completely engaged. The charging cable must not be stretched.

  • Page 28: Cleaning The Components

    CLEANING THE COMPONENTS INFORMATION! Only clean the charging cable when it is not connected to the vehicle or the charging station. Use a dry cloth to clean outside of cable, Vehicle Connector, Equipment Plug and pin contacts. Never use abrasive cleaning agents, water jet or steam jet cleaners.
